We have a problem where y equals 112 when x equals 4, and we need to find the value of k. We assume this follows a direct variation relationship, where y equals k times x. Let's visualize this with the given point on a coordinate system.
Now we substitute the given values into our formula. We know that y equals 112 and x equals 4. Substituting these into y equals k times x gives us 112 equals k times 4. This creates an equation we can solve for k.
Now we solve for k by dividing both sides of the equation by 4. We have 112 equals k times 4. Dividing both sides by 4 gives us 112 divided by 4 equals k. Calculating 112 divided by 4 gives us 28. Therefore, k equals 28.
Let's verify our answer by substituting k equals 28 back into the original equation. When k equals 28 and x equals 4, we get y equals 28 times 4, which equals 112. This matches our given value, confirming our answer is correct. Therefore, k equals 28, which is already expressed to 1 decimal place.
To summarize what we learned: We identified this as a direct variation problem where y equals k times x. We substituted the given values and solved the resulting equation to find that k equals 28. Finally, we verified our answer by checking it against the original condition.
